Abstract

The utility model provides a wastewater stripper plant. The wastewater stripper plant structurally comprises a wastewater tank, a wastewater pump, a wastewater stripper tower and a tower bottom pump, wherein a polymerization wastewater inlet is formed in the upper part of the wastewater tank, the bottom of the wastewater tank is connected with the upper part of the wastewater stripper tower by a connecting pipeline connected with the wastewater pump in series, a chloroethylene-steam mixture outlet is formed in the top of the wastewater stripper tower, a steam inlet is formed in the lower part of the wastewater stripper tower, and the tower bottom pump is arranged at the bottom of the wastewater stripper tower, is connected with the middle lower part of the wastewater stripper tower by a backflow pipe and is also connected with a wastewater treatment device. According to the wastewater stripper plant, due to the utilization of heat energy of steam, chloroethylene dissolved in polymerization wastewater is taken away and is recycled, the calcium carbide consumption amount is lowered, the water pollution is reduced; and the wastewater stripper plant is suitable for production enterprises of polyvinyl chloride by a calcium carbide method.

Background technology
Polymerization waste water mainly comes from the polymeric kettle wash-down water, the steam stripped tower aftercondenser of slurry water of condensation, dissolving and carried a small amount of vinylchlorid (2000-20000PPm) and resin secretly in the waste water, unprocessed at present, directly discharge to treatment tank by trench, vinylchlorid in the water evaporates atmosphere is polluted, work the mischief to the execute-in-place worker is healthy, and vinylchlorid gathers at trench for a long time, the trench blast easily occurs when meeting naked light, cause security incident, to make in the waste water content of vinylchloride reach emission standard be very necessary so this part waste water effectively processed.

The technical scheme that its technical problem that solves the utility model adopts is:
Wastewater Stripping Unit, comprise waste water tank, waste water pump, water vaporization tower and column bottoms pump, the top of described waste water tank is provided with the polymerization waterwater entrance, the bottom of waste water tank is connected with the top of water vaporization tower by the connecting tube that is in series with waste water pump, the top of water vaporization tower is provided with the mixture outlet of vinylchlorid and water vapour, the bottom of water vaporization tower is provided with steam inlet, the bottom of water vaporization tower is provided with column bottoms pump, column bottoms pump both was connected with the middle and lower part of water vaporization tower by return line, was connected with wastewater treatment equipment again.
Column bottoms pump is incorporated into a part of waste water again in the water vaporization tower by return line, and another part waste water is delivered to wastewater treatment equipment.
Wastewater Stripping Unit of the present utility model, its stripping process and slurry stripping process are similar.In water vaporization tower, waste water is entered in the tower by cat head, and steam enters in the tower at the bottom of by tower, in waste water and the steam counter-flow process, at column plate place mass-and heat-transfer, to overflow from cat head with the vinyl chloride gas of saturation steam and to reclaim into the recovery compressor, the waste water of treated mistake enters trench at the bottom of by tower.
Wastewater Stripping Unit of the present utility model compared with prior art, the beneficial effect that produces is:
The utility model is taken away the vinylchlorid that dissolves in the polymerization waste water, and is recycled by utilizing the heat energy of steam, reduces consumption of calcium carbide, reduces the water pollution, is applicable to generated by polyvinyl chloride by calcium carbide manufacturing enterprise.

Wastewater Stripping Unit of the present utility model adopts the DCS centralized Control.During driving, open first the steam inlet valve of water vaporization tower, low discharge passes into steam; Open the valve that cat head leads to gas holder; Open tower waste water inlet valve, progressively increase the valve opening of steam and waste water, make tower pressure reduction be stabilized in a certain numerical value, system is dropped into automatically control.
During parking, progressively turn down the waste water imported valve first, steam valve is along with reducing, until close down.Close down cat head towards the valve of gas holder, stop.
In Wastewater Stripping Unit, the intake of steam is crucial: flux is excessive, and water temperature is overheated, causes waste; Flux is too small, does not reach steam stripped purpose.The pressure of stripping tower outlet will be stablized, and not so causes the tower operation unstable.
